Final Fantasy 15 Active Time Report Scheduled for August 29th at PAX Prime

Director Hajime Tabata to share "a few personal stories" about development.

Posted By | On 21st, Aug. 2015

Final Fantasy 15

Following its presentation at Gamescom 2015, Square Enix said it would talk more about Final Fantasy 15 at PAX Prime. It’s now announced that the next Active Time Report will be held on August 29th, 4.30 PM PST at PAX Prime in the Grand Hyatt Seattle Hotel. Director Hajime Tabata will be present and this will mark his first North American ATB presentation.

Tabata already revealed shortly after Gamescom that Final Fantasy 15 would be releasing before 2017, which we pretty much took to mean a confirmed 2016 release date. At PAX Prime, Tabata will speak more about the Dawn trailer and provide a “few personal stories” about the game’s development. Will that include the game’s torturous trip through development limbo?
